📈 주식 뉴스 리포트

KRX 데이터 + 자연어 처리 기반으로 관심 분야 기업 추천과 뉴스 반응 분석을 자동화한 프로젝트입니다.

📌 프로젝트 구조

  1. 상장기업 데이터 확보: KRX로부터 약 2,700개의 상장기업 데이터를 수집합니다.

  2. 업종 및 종목명 임베딩: 기업의 업종명과 종목명을 텍스트 임베딩 처리하여 벡터화합니다.

  3. 임베딩 결과 저장: 유사도 계산 속도 향상을 위해 결과를 .pkl 형식으로 저장합니다.

  4. 키워드 기반 유사 기업 추천: 사용자의 관심 키워드를 임베딩하여 유사한 기업을 추천합니다.

  5. 네이버 뉴스 연동: 추천된 기업명을 바탕으로 네이버 뉴스 API를 통해 관련 기사를 수집합니다.

  6. 뉴스 분석 및 여론 파악: 기사 내용을 유사도 기반으로 정렬하고, 감성 분석을 통해 투자 여론을 시각화합니다.